The Role

The Speech Language Pathologist is a licensed healthcare professional responsible for the comprehensive evaluation, diagnosis, treatment planning, and implementation of speech, language, cognitive-communication, and swallowing disorder management programs. This position is classified as Non-Exempt and reports to the Director of Rehabilitation and the Facility Administrator.

Core responsibilities include:

  • Conducting comprehensive speech-language and swallowing evaluations in accordance with physician orders and Arizona standards of practice
  • Assessing and diagnosing speech, language, voice, fluency, cognitive-communication, and dysphagia disorders
  • Developing, implementing, and modifying individualized plans of care with measurable, function-based goals consistent with benefit and reimbursement levels
  • Providing skilled therapeutic interventions addressing communication, cognition, swallowing safety, and compensatory strategy development
  • Performing clinical swallowing evaluations and providing dysphagia management within scope of practice and competency
  • Monitoring patient progress and adjusting treatment plans based on objective findings and clinical response
  • Supporting and instructing patients and families in techniques and behavioral adaptations to promote better communication and swallowing outcomes
  • Leading discharge planning and providing recommendations to support safe transitions of care and community reintegration
  • Communicating evaluation findings, progress updates, and discharge outcomes to physicians, interdisciplinary team members, patients, and families while maintaining confidentiality in accordance with HIPAA
